And for totals, select your cell(s) and click the down arrow next to the underline button on the ribbon, You’ll find a choice there for double underline. (If you underline first, it won’t work.) In Excel this is called Accounting Underline. Or will it? If you first format cells with either the comma format or the accounting format and then format the text as underlined, the underline will extend almost the entire width of the column.

You could format the text in the headings to be underlined, but then the line will only be as wide as the text or numbers in the cell. But that is tedious to set up and interferes with using the ctrl+arrow or End+arrow keyboard shortcuts.

A common solution is to have very narrow empty columns between the columns of data. But for totals or subtotals, many people don’t like the continuous line that it creates they would prefer a separate underline in each column. Putting a bottom border on a row of cells can be a good choice for column headings on a spreadsheet.
